Many Auckland roofing contractors miss a key opportunity by using a business description under 400 characters, despite Google allowing 750. This means you're not fully detailing your expertise in metal roofing, tile repairs, or spouting services, nor are you mentioning specific Auckland suburbs you service. A short description fails to tell Google's algorithm what you truly offer, diminishing your chances of appearing for relevant local searches and showcasing your full capabilities to potential customers needing roof work.
Beyond just 'Roofing contractor,' many profiles in Auckland overlook vital secondary categories that signal their full range of services to Google. Without adding 'Roof Repair Service,' 'Emergency Roofing Service,' and 'Roof Inspection Service,' your business might not appear for customers specifically searching for those needs. This limits your visibility for critical, high-intent local searches and allows competitors who have optimised these categories to capture those urgent Auckland leads first.
Most Auckland roofing contractors have fewer than 30 owner-uploaded photos, a significant oversight when visuals build trust. Profiles often lack crucial images like high-quality 'before and after' shots of completed re-roofs, team photos showing local faces, or diverse project examples across different Auckland suburbs. Missing these detailed visuals means potential clients can't easily see the quality of your work or your team's professionalism, often leading them to choose a competitor with a more visually rich and transparent profile.
